반응형
안녕하세요. 마술공입니다.
MS-SQL에서 테이블의 컬럼을 추가, 삭제, 변경하는 스크립트를 소개해드립니다.
스크립트를 직접 보면 직관적으로 의미를 파악할 수 있으니 작업에 참고하시기 바랍니다.
예제 스크립트
테이블에 컬럼 추가
ALTER TABLE dbo.CUSTOMER_INFO ADD gender int NULL
CUSTOMER_INFO 테이블에 gender 컬럼을 int형으로 추가
테이블의 컬럼 데이터 타입 변경
ALTER TABLE dbo.CUSTOMER_INFO ALTER COLUMN gender char(1) NOT NULL
gender 컬럼의 데이터 타입을 char(1)로 변경, NULL옵션을 NOT NULL로 변경
테이블의 컬럼 명칭 변경
EXEC SP_RENAME 'dbo.CUSTOMER_INFO.gender', 'gender_cd', 'column'
컬럼 명을 gender에서 gender_cd로 변경
테이블에서 컬럼 삭제
ALTER TABLE dbo.CUSTOMER_INFO DROP COLUMN gender_cd
CUSTOMER_INFO 테이블에 gender_cd 컬럼을 제거
반응형
'IT 이야기 > DB' 카테고리의 다른 글
[MSSQL] EXISTS문 사용법 및 예제 (0) | 2022.08.31 |
---|---|
데이터베이스 관리자(DBA) 직무, 기술면접 질문 정리 (0) | 2022.08.30 |
[MSSQL] CASE문 표현식 (case when) (0) | 2022.08.29 |
[MSSQL] 테이블 생성 (Create table) (0) | 2022.08.26 |
45회 SQLP 합격 후기 (SQL 전문가) 및 공부법 (5) | 2022.08.25 |